Handover note — Crumbwheel order cutoffs.

Welcome aboard. The bakery cutoff rule in Crumbwheel closes same-day orders at 14:00 local to each storefront, not UTC — this has bitten us twice. Holiday overrides live in the calendar service and take precedence silently, so always check there first when a cutoff looks wrong. To unlock the calendar service's admin console after a restart, enter the recovery passphrase below.

vault phrase of bagap-bahaf = silion-pelox-sorox-casdor-quenwyn-fraax-eliox-praael-kelion-quenvan-kasox-rusael-norius-belvan

# Break-Glass: Catalog Cache Invalidation

Scope: the Pinrow product catalog at Veldstone Retail. If stale prices persist after a purge and the Hollowmere invalidation queue is wedged, use break-glass to flush the edge tier directly. Contractors: get verbal sign-off from the catalog lead first. Steps: open the Hollowmere admin shell, select emergency-flush, confirm the tenant, and run it once — repeated flushes thrash the origin. Access is logged and expires after 20 minutes. Unseal the admin shell with the passphrase below.

recovery phrase for kahop-tajog: istix-casvan

Subject: Recon cut-over done — welcome aboard

Hi! Quick recap so you're not lost on day one. We moved the Stockweave reconciliation job off the old nightly batch onto the new streaming runner over the weekend. Went mostly smoothly — one hiccup with a stale warehouse snapshot in the Verlane region, already resolved. The job now reconciles every two hours instead of nightly, so expect smaller diffs. Everything you'll need to run it locally is driven by the settings pasted below.

settings of tagef-bawif:
DRUIX_HOST=druix.zemvarlabs.internal
DRUIX_PORT=8000